What does the route price include?
The price includes: certified guide, e-bike, helmet, water, energy bar and gel, sunscreen, RC + accident + rescue insurance, and photo and video report of your experience.
What do I need to bring?
You only need sports clothes and footwear, sunglasses, a small backpack and, in winter, light warm clothing. Everything else is included in the price.
Is it hard to pedal an e-bike?
Not at all. The e-bikes have 4 electric assistance modes that help you especially on climbs. They are suitable for any physical level, even people who have not ridden a bike in years.
Are the routes for everyone?
We have routes for different levels: from the most accessible for beginners (Volcanoes, Mala, Famara) to the most demanding for advanced riders (North, South, North to South). With the e-bike all are accessible.
What is the cancellation policy?
Cancellation with more than 24h notice: 100% refund minus management fees. Less than 24h: no refund. Date changes are not considered cancellations and have no additional cost.
Do you have all the required insurance?
Yes. We have all the insurance required by the Active Tourism Department of the Canary Islands Government: Civil Liability Insurance, Personal Accident Insurance and Rescue Insurance.

1. What are cookies?
Cookies are small text files that a website installs in the User's browser or device when they visit it. Among other functions, they make it possible to store and retrieve information about the User's or their device's browsing habits, remember preferences, maintain the status of a process (such as a booking in progress), or recognize the User on subsequent visits. Depending on the information they contain and how they are used, cookies can be used to recognize the User and obtain information about their preferences.

4. Types of cookies according to their purpose
Technical or necessary cookies: these are essential for the operation of the Website and for the provision of the service expressly requested by the User, such as remembering the selected language or maintaining the status of a booking in progress. They do not require the User's consent, in accordance with the exception provided for in article 22.2 of the LSSI-CE.
Preference or personalization cookies: these allow information to be remembered so that the User can access the service with certain features that may differentiate their experience, such as language.
Analytics or measurement cookies: these make it possible to quantify the number of users and carry out statistical analysis of how users use the service. As of the date of this update, the Website does not use its own analytics cookies, nor third-party ones such as Google Analytics.
Advertising or third-party cookies for commercial purposes: these allow the management of advertising space. The Website does not currently use cookies of this kind.
